Jane Howard Selected for County Board of Education
The Santa Clara County Board of Education is the elected governing body of the Santa Clara County Office of Education (COE). Its seven members serve four-year terms and are elected from different regions of the county.  The Board sets the policies that guide the COE, establishes the operating budget, and appoints the County Superintendent.
 
Of the dozen people who applied to fill the term of District 7 trustee Don Kruse, who resigned for health reasons, the board chose Jane Howard to fill the position.  Jane is the past president of the Gilroy Unified School District Board of Trustees and interim executive director of the Gilroy Economic Development Corporation.
 
With an accounting background, Jane, a former businesswoman, has dedicated many volunteer hours to the community. In addition to her service for the Gilroy Unified School District, Jane has served as president of the Gilroy Chamber of Commerce, Chair of the South Valley Hospital Board of Directors, Director of the Gilroy Garlic Festival, President of the Leadership Gilroy Foundation, and many more community associations too numerous to mention.
 
In addition to her many civic responsibilities, Jane is an elected member of the Santa Clara County Republican Party and a delegate and member of the California Republican Party.  She has also served as campaign treasurer for Supervisor Don Gage, as well as, several Gilroy mayors and city council members.
